UNISOC and Quectel jointly launched a new 5G smart module-SG530C-CN equipped with Zhanrui P7885, which adopts 6nm EUV advanced technology and octa-core 1+3+4 three-cluster CPU architecture, integrated Arm Mali-G57 quad-core GPU, running frequency 850MHz, NPU computing power reaches 8 TOPS.

Picture source Ziguang Zhanrui Weibo

UNISOC that the Quectel SG530C-CN module is developed based on UNISOC P7885 and complies with the 3GPP Release 15 standard. In addition to supporting 5G NSA and SA modes, it is also backwards compatible with 4G / 3G networks and supports Wi-Fi, Bluetooth and other network standards.

At the same time, SG530C-CN also supports 5G NR & 4G LTE multiple-input multiple-output technology (MIMO), which can use multiple receiving antennas at the receiving end at the same time and in the same frequency band, thereby greatly reducing the bit error rate and improving communication quality.

Quectel official website

In addition, on the basis of supporting 4K H.265/ H.264 60FPS video codec, the SG530C-CN can support simultaneous input of up to 4 camera video streams, dual-screen/three-screen different displays and other functions.

For multi-industry smart terminals, SG530C-CN has a built-in multi-constellation GNSS receiver, supports GPS, GLONASS, BDS and Galileo positioning systems, and also integrates interface functions including PCIe, DisplayPort, and USB3.1.

UNISOC unveiled its first ultra-high-definition smart display chip platform, the M6780, at MWC Shanghai. The chip platform supports 8K decoding and HDR full format, and claims to have highly integrated CPU, GPU, NPU, VDSP, ADSP AI computing power.

In terms of specific configuration, UNISOC M6780 integrates Arm Cortex-A762 + Arm Cortex-A552, equipped with Arm Mali-G57 4 cores GPU, and supports mainstream decoding protocols such as H.264 / H.265 / VP9 / AV1 / AVS .

▲ The source of the picture is UNISOC, the same below

UNISOC M6780 chip platform supports mainstream HD formats: Dolby Vision, HDR10, HDR10+, HLG, and adopts AI-SR super-resolution technology, AI-PQ intelligent image enhancement, and MEMC dynamic compensation technology.

UNISOC’s AI-SR (Super Resolution) algorithm module claims to have passed millions of deep learning training to appropriately supplement the detailed textures required for video amplification, thereby reducing low-resolution images to detailed high-definition images. The M6780 supports 36x pixel magnification, and claims to be able to magnify 720p images to 8K ultra-high-definition images.

M6780 supports AI-PQ (Picture Quality) to intelligently identify various scene images, and adjust the brightness, saturation, sharpness, and contrast of the image frame by frame, claiming to achieve a more realistic image effect.

UNISOC M6780 is equipped with a frame rate conversion module based on MEMC (Motion Estimation and Motion Compensation) technology, which includes functions such as Cadence detection, Logo detection, motion estimation, motion compensation, and halo elimination to obtain continuous and smooth image sequences. It can effectively eliminate screen jitter, motion blur and smearing.

In terms of sound quality, UNISOC has developed a full-link sound quality improvement solution from audio codec to playback sound processing, including AI-AQ, sound field calibration, Dolby Atoms, etc., and supports intelligent sound adjustment technology for playback content With adaptive calibration technology for the sound field.

UNISOC M6780 is equipped with UNISOC’s self-developed AI-AQ algorithm. Based on AI technology, it perceives the audio content being played, and intelligently adjusts the EQ parameters for playback according to the recognition results of different scenes, so as to match different content with a more suitable balance. Effect.

In terms of interaction, UNISOC M6780 can realize intelligent interaction with users through functions such as AI-Voice, AI gesture recognition, AI human body key point recognition, AI-protected crowd viewing recognition, and AI scene recognition.

In terms of games, UNISOC M6780 supports HDMI 2.1, VRR, and ALLM technologies.

The official microblog of Unisco has recently updated its article to announce the official launch of its new 5G platform, the Unisco T750.

The T750 uses a 6nm EUV process. It has an octa-core CPU architecture with two 2.0GHz Arm Cortex-A76 performance cores and a Mali G57 dual-core GPU architecture with UFS 3.1 and LPDDR4X for faster read and write speeds.

In terms of communication, this 5G platform supports 5G dual-carrier aggregation technology, SA and NSA dual-mode, dual SIM dual 5G; in terms of video, it supports 64MP HD photography, as well as 2K video recording and EIS video anti-shake.

In terms of display, the T750 supports FHD+ screen resolution, 90Hz high refresh rate, and HDR10+ HD display. The video display supports DCI contrast enhancement and provides an eye protection display in blue light, sunlight, and night light environments.

The Unisco T750 adopts many advanced technologies of the second-generation 5G mobile platform from Unisco, supporting 2G to 5G multi-mode all-networking, SA and NSA networking modes, and supporting 130MHz bandwidth dual-carrier aggregation technology, which allows smart terminals to connect to two 5G bands at the same time, providing wider 5G network coverage and higher 5G transmission rates.

From the official information of the IMT-2020 (5G) promotion group of the China Academy of Information and Communications Technology, UNISOC and ZTE recently successfully completed the 5G R17 version of RedCap key technology laboratory verification and Beijing Huairou field performance test , which is another major achievement of UNISOC in the field of 5G R17 RedCap technology.

The 5G R17 RedCap key technology and field performance test used ZTE 5G NR base station and UNISOC 5G R17 RedCap platform to test the terminal.

Among them, the key technology verification of 5G R17 RedCap has completed the technical verification of functions and performances such as cell access and camping of RedCap terminals, cell reselection and handover, coexistence of RedCap UE and Legacy UE, uplink and downlink peak rate and delay.

The 5G R17 RedCap field performance test has completed the verification of test contents including RedCap UE access and basic workflow, single-user peak throughput, multi-point access and throughput, user plane delay, and mobility test.

According to reports, 5G R17 RedCap can greatly reduce the cost and power consumption of 5G terminals by reducing the complexity of terminal radio frequency and baseband. 5G R17 RedCap, as a key 5G technology and solution for medium and high-speed IoT and industrial IoT scenarios, can be mainly used in wearable devices, industrial IoT and video applications and other application scenarios.
